PhD degree – Trial Lecture and Public Defence
Katarzyna Kuczkowska, Faculty of Chemistry, Biotechnology and Food Science (KBM) will defend her PhD thesis "Development of Lactobacillus plantarum as a potential vehicle for delivery of antigens to mucosal sites" on 13 January 2017.

Norwegian title of thesis:
"Utvikling av Lactobacillus plantarum som potensiell leveringsvektor av antigener til slimhinner"

Prescribed subject of the trial lecture:
"Gut commensals in health and disease"
